Executive summary

  • Focus on acquiring established retail and shopping centers with strong anchor tenants and low vacancy or investment needs, mainly in small to mid-sized cities.

  • Buy-and-hold strategy aims for sustainable double-digit equity returns.

  • Portfolio expanded to 91 properties as of June 30, 2025, with 13 acquisitions and several new tenant agreements.

  • Significant operational focus on property takeovers, renovations, and long-term lease signings.

Financial highlights

  • Funds From Operations (FFO) for H1 2025 at €5.5M, up 8% year-over-year.

  • Revenue for H1 2025 increased 16% to €15.2M compared to H1 2024.

  • Net income for H1 2025 at €1.8M, down 38% year-over-year, impacted by a prior-year one-off gain.

  • Portfolio value rose 23% to €344M as of June 30, 2025.

  • EPS for H1 2025 at €0.62.

Outlook and guidance

  • 2025 targets: FFO > €11M, net income (HGB) > €5M, dividend > €0.60 per share.

  • Long-term plan for 2030: portfolio value €500M, annualized rental income €42M, FFO €19M or >€4.00 per share.

  • Management confirms 2025 targets and expects further property acquisitions and asset sales in H2 2025.

  • Ongoing renovations and new leases anticipated to drive future rental income growth.

  • Inflation-linked leases and long average debt maturities support resilience in a volatile market.
